Transaction 58c1800e2aa26b247d8186426bc2c9bf2410e0d64c68161f70abfe89b92735c9
1 Input
1 Output
-
58c1800e2aa26b247d8186426bc2c9bf2410e0d64c68161f70abfe89b92735c9:0
- value
- 46643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86decba582127dda6f17b89babadfd3057abcb48 OP_EQUAL
- address
- 3Dz9NMLCb9xfcD1A2ErbBE4zGqdFi5DF4J